For pure gaming performance — response time, motion clarity, and frame-to-frame precision — the two technologies are functionally identical. Both produce sub-0.5ms pixel transitions with zero ghosting. You cannot distinguish QD-OLED from Tandem OLED by motion performance alone.

The differences that matter in practice are environmental and use-case specific. QD-OLED produces more vivid, punchy colors that make HDR games pop — especially reds, neon greens, and saturated environments. Tandem OLED handles ambient light better, sustains brightness more consistently, and (in its RGB-stripe variant) renders desktop text without fringing.

QD-OLED's ambient light tint is the most polarizing factor. In a dim gaming room, it's invisible and irrelevant. In a bright room with windows or overhead lighting, the purple haze on dark content can be distracting enough that some users return the monitor. If you can control your room lighting, QD-OLED's color advantage wins. If you can't, Tandem OLED is the safer bet.

The Verdict

Choose QD-OLED if you game primarily in a dim or dark room, want the most vivid HDR colors, and prioritize value (QD-OLED is typically cheaper at the same size and refresh rate).

Choose Tandem OLED if you game in a bright room, split time between gaming and desktop work (especially if text quality matters), or want the highest available refresh rates (540Hz Tandem WOLED is currently the fastest OLED).

Choose Tandem RGB OLED specifically if desktop text clarity is non-negotiable and you want the only OLED technology that renders text like an LCD — no fringing, no compromises. This is the best all-around panel for mixed gaming and productivity, but it carries a premium price and has the gray-banding limitation in dark scenes.

Neither technology is universally "better." They're different tools optimized for different environments. The right choice depends on your room, your use case, and your priorities.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is QD-OLED or Tandem OLED faster for gaming?

They're identical in motion performance. Both achieve sub-0.5ms response times with zero ghosting. No competitive gamer can gain an advantage from choosing one over the other based on speed alone.

Which has better HDR?

QD-OLED produces more vivid saturated colors in HDR, which makes neon-heavy and color-rich content more impressive. Tandem OLED (especially WRGB variants) sustains higher brightness across larger screen areas, which makes full-screen bright scenes more impactful. It depends on whether you value color vibrancy or sustained brightness more.

Can I use QD-OLED in a bright room?

You can, but the purple/grey ambient light tint on dark content will be visible. Some users find it acceptable; others find it distracting. Newer QD-OLED panels with improved anti-reflective coatings reduce the effect. If possible, view a QD-OLED in your actual room lighting before committing to purchase.
